What is the primary conflict in HALFWAY TO HELL?

The primary conflict in HALFWAY TO HELL involves a deputy sheriff who must compete against six dangerous killers. The central objective for all parties is the search for stolen gold that has been hidden.

Is HALFWAY TO HELL a story about a lawman?

Yes, HALFWAY TO HELL features a deputy sheriff as the protagonist. He finds himself in a high-stakes situation where he must track down stolen gold while facing off against six different killers.
